How are offshore corporations used?

Offshore jurisdictions can offer a wide variety of legal and financial benefits to the discriminating individual, entrepreneur or investor. However, it can take years or even decades to obtain the necessary citizenship - as well as a significant disruption to your business and persona life - in order to take advantage of what these countries have to offer.

However, by establishing your company as a corporation in an offshore jurisdiction, these same advantages can become available to you. Let’s take a look at how offshore corporations are used in order to organize, maintain, protect and accumulate wealth.

Global access - incorporating in an offshore jurisdiction affords you the ability to invest in, conduct transactions with and protect other foreign corporations.

Asset protection - through your offshore corporation, you can consolidate your worldwide wealth and protect your assets from creditors, lawsuit judgments, estate taxes and other interests.

Portfolio management - many corporations use offshore jurisdictions as a way to manage employee pensions and benefits. The privacy and tax advantages afforded to offshore corporations provide ample financial opportunities not available in your home country.

Confidentiality - Offshore jurisdictions are fiercely proud of their commitment to your privacy. To this end, there are a variety of ways your corporation can be shielded, from blind trusts to third party administration.
